Wonderful, first class lens, about half the weight and half the length of a 70-210 f/4 beer can and equal or nearly equal in image quality. I tested it on a Sony A99 (24MP full frame camera). I've found myself running out of pixels before sharpness is my benchmark for lens sharpness. Use the flash indoors and fast shutter speeds outdoors and you'll be amazed at the sharpness and clarity of this lens with great colors. Use f/8 if you can. This lens is not a full analog of the 70-210 f/4, but it comes very close, being much smaller and lighter. At the prices of these lenses today, you can afford one of these lenses, use this if weight and size are a concern. I didn't notice any flaws or flaws during testing.
